Malware Activity

Browser-Based Evasion and GitHub Infrastructure Abuse Signal a New Era of Cyber Threats

Security researchers have uncovered two (2) highly sophisticated cyber campaigns that highlight how attackers are increasingly abusing trusted technologies to evade detection and expand their reach. In the first case, the Chaos ransomware group is using a newly identified malware called msaRAT, which routes its command-and-control (C2) communications through legitimate browsers like Google Chrome and Microsoft Edge using encrypted WebRTC connections and the Chrome DevTools Protocol. By disguising traffic as normal browser activity and leveraging trusted services such as Cloudflare Workers and Twilio TURN servers, the malware becomes significantly harder for traditional security tools to identify. Separately, researchers discovered a large-scale operation abusing compromised GitHub repositories and GitHub Actions runners to automatically scan for and exploit vulnerable cPanel and WHM servers through CVE-2026-41940. Once successful, attackers attempt to steal valuable data including cloud credentials, API keys, SSH keys, database information, and payment service credentials. Together, these incidents demonstrate a growing trend where threat actors weaponize legitimate cloud platforms, developer tools, and browser technologies to conceal malicious activity, emphasizing the need for stronger phishing protections, vigilant monitoring of browser-based network behavior, and rapid review of published indicators of compromise (IoCs). Threat Actor Activity

Chick-fil-a Member Loyalty Accounts Hit by Credential Stuffing Breach

Chick-fil-a is notifying customers of a data breach after credential stuffing attacks compromised “Chick-fil-a One” accounts via its website and mobile app between June 17th and 19th, 2026. Attackers used stolen usernames and passwords from third-party sources to log in, potentially accessing names, email addresses, membership and mobile pay numbers, QR codes, Chick-fil-a credit balances, and the last four (4) digits of payment cards, plus any stored birth dates, phone numbers, and addresses. The company hasn’t disclosed total affected accounts but reported impacts to residents in multiple US states, including Texas and Massachusetts. In response, Chick-fil-a logged out impacted users, removed stored payment methods, restored account balances, and added rewards, advising customers to change passwords. This follows a similar credential stuffing incident Chick-fil-a disclosed in March 2023 that affected over 71,000 customers.

Vulnerabilities

Active Exploitation of Check Point SmartConsole Authentication Bypass Prompts Urgent Patching

Check Point has released security updates to address three (3) high-severity vulnerabilities affecting its Security Management and Multi-Domain Security Management (MDSM) products, including the actively exploited zero-day CVE-2026-16232 (CVSS 9.3), an authentication bypass flaw that allows unauthenticated remote attackers to obtain a SmartConsole login token and authenticate with full administrative privileges. Successful exploitation enables attackers to modify security policies and configurations, though attacks require management servers to be directly exposed to the internet without firewall protections or Trusted Client IP restrictions. Check Point confirmed that a limited number of customers have been targeted, privately notified affected organizations, and published indicators of compromise (IoCs), but has not attributed the attacks, although the Qilin ransomware group has recently been observed targeting Check Point appliances. The company also patched CVE-2026-62144, a critical authentication bypass vulnerability that enables unauthenticated execution of administrative commands on management servers, and CVE-2026-62145, a high-severity privilege escalation flaw affecting Gaia Portal and related management components that allows authenticated users with limited privileges to gain root access. All three (3) vulnerabilities impact multiple product versions, and customers are urged to install the July 22 Jumbo Hotfix, restrict management access to trusted IP addresses, enable firewall protections, and review internet-exposed management interfaces. Due to confirmed in-the-wild exploitation, the U.S. Cybersecurity and Infrastructure Security Agency (CISA) has added CVE-2026-16232 to its Known Exploited Vulnerabilities (KEV) catalog, requiring U.S. federal agencies to remediate affected systems by no later than July 25, 2026.
